The High Court has directed the authorities concerned to move the mobile phone companies’ towers, or Base Transceiver Stations used for cellular transmission, from densely populated areas across the country within 4 months, according to a recently published complete copy of an HC verdict.

A bench of justice Syed Refaat Ahmed and justice Md Iqbal Kabir passed the order on 25 April considering the health risks posed to people by radiation in the vicinity of the towers, after hearing a writ petition filed by Human Rights and Peace for Bangladesh.


The complete copy of the order which was published on Tuesday also presented a 12-point direction which should be implemented within four months, said the petitioner Manzil Murshid.

Khondokar Reza-i-Rakin stood for Bangladesh Telecommunication Regulatory Commission (BTRC) while deputy attorney general Kazi Zinat Haque represented the state.
